On 05/12/17 23:47, Jason Ekstrand wrote: > On Tue, Dec 5, 2017 at 1:36 PM, Jose Maria Casanova Crespo > <jmcasan...@igalia.com <mailto:jmcasan...@igalia.com>> wrote: > > SSBO loads were using byte_scattered read messages as they allow > reading 16-bit size components. byte_scattered messages can only > operate one component at a time so we needed to emit as many messages > as components. > > But for vec2 and vec4 of 16-bit, being multiple of 32-bit we can use the > untyped_surface_read message to read pairs of 16-bit components using > only one message. Once each pair is read it is unshuffled to return the > proper 16-bit components. vec3 case is assimilated to vec4 but the 4th > component is ignored. > > 16-bit scalars are read using one byte_scattered_read message. > > v2: Removed use of stride = 2 on sources (Jason Ekstrand) > Rework optimization using unshuffle 16 reads (Chema Casanova) > v3: Use W and D types insead of HF and F in shuffle to avoid rounding > erros (Jason Ekstrand) > Use untyped_surface_read for 16-bit vec3.
